AC Milan are one of three teams in the running to land Juventus winger Federico Bernardeschi, a report claims, along with two LaLiga giants.

Milan were heavily linked with Bernardeschi in January with several outlets reporting that a swap deal with Juventus involving Lucas Paqueta was being discussed.

It was claimed in the winter window by TMW that Milan would welcome Bernardeschi, something intermediaries and the Italian’s entourage are already aware of, and that Juventus were interested in the aforementioned exchange.

Last month, Romeo Agresti claimed that Bernardeschi could leave the Bianconeri this summer after three seasons, revealing that the Rossoneri are still interested in the idea of signing the Italy international, who cost Juve €40m.

According to il Corriere dello Sport (via MilanNews), Federico Bernardeschi’s future at Juventus is hanging in the balance. The Italy international will have to impress when/if the season resumes to convince the Bianconeri that he can still be an important part of their project.

The paper claims that three teams in particular are watching the situation closely: namely Barcelona, ​​Atletico Madrid and Milan.
